The Legacy of the Shadowed Throne

In the heart of the ancient land of Elyndara, where the sun dipped low behind the mountains and the stars began to twinkle, lived a girl named Elara. She was known as the quiet one, the one who preferred the company of books over the throngs of her peers. But beneath the surface of her mundane existence, a storm brewed, a tempest of destiny that would soon sweep her into a world far beyond her wildest dreams.

Elara had always felt a strange pull, a sense of connection to the ancient stones and the whispered legends of her ancestors. As a child, she had spent countless hours tracing the carvings on the walls of her family's old manor, each one a story of heroes and monsters, love and loss. The tales spoke of a throne, the Seat of Shadows, which was said to hold the power to shape the very fate of the world. But the throne was not just an object of power; it was a curse, a burden that no one could bear alone.

One fateful night, as Elara lay in her bed, a voice called her name. It was the voice of her great-grandmother, the voice of her ancestors, and it spoke of the throne, of her destiny. "Elara," it said, "you are the chosen one. It is time for you to claim the Seat of Shadows."

Intrigued yet terrified, Elara rose from her bed and made her way to the library. There, amidst the dusty tomes and forgotten artifacts, she found an ancient scroll. It spoke of the Seat of Shadows, a throne made from the bones of dragons and the hearts of heroes, a throne that could only be claimed by the one born to wield its power. Elara felt the scroll's magic course through her veins, a strange warmth that she knew could not be denied.

The next morning, Elara's family was gone. They had been called away on an urgent matter, and Elara was left alone with the knowledge that she was the one destined to claim the throne. She knew that the road ahead would be fraught with danger, filled with those who would seek to claim the throne for themselves.

Her first challenge came in the form of a mysterious figure who appeared at her door. He called himself the Guardian of the Shadows, and he warned her of the dark forces that sought to control the throne. "You must be wary, Elara," he said. "The throne is not a gift, but a burden. You must be strong and brave, for you will face many who would see you fail."

Elara nodded, knowing that she had no choice but to embrace her destiny. She set out on her journey, traveling through the treacherous lands of Elyndara, meeting allies and enemies alike. She encountered the ancient dragon, Sorem, who had once guarded the throne but had been bound by an evil sorcerer. Sorem offered his aid, but at a great cost. "I can help you claim the throne, but you must prove your worth," he said.

Elara's journey took her to the forbidden city of Zorath, a place shrouded in darkness and mystery. There, she encountered the sorcerer, Malakar, who sought the throne for his own selfish desires. In a fierce battle of wits and wills, Elara outsmarted the sorcerer, freeing Sorem in the process.

With Sorem's help, Elara made her way to the throne room, where the Seat of Shadows stood, gleaming with an otherworldly light. As she approached the throne, she felt the darkness within her rise, a darkness that threatened to consume her. But she remembered the words of the Guardian of the Shadows, and she pushed the darkness back, embracing the light instead.

With a mighty roar, Elara claimed the Seat of Shadows, and the power of the throne coursed through her veins. She felt the weight of her destiny, the weight of the entire world resting upon her shoulders. But she was ready. She had faced her fears, overcome her doubts, and embraced her destiny.

In the end, Elara realized that the throne was not just a symbol of power; it was a symbol of responsibility. She knew that she had to be the leader her people needed, the protector of the innocent, and the one who would bring light to the darkness.

As the first light of dawn broke through the clouds, Elara sat upon the Seat of Shadows, her heart filled with resolve. She was ready to face whatever lay ahead, for she was the chosen one, the one destined to rule the world with wisdom and justice.

And so, the legend of Elara, the teenage conqueror of the Shadowed Throne, was born.
